Traffic signals restored at U.S. 278/4th Avenue

Published 11:24 am Monday, December 4, 2017

The traffic signal at U.S. 278 and 4th Avenue has been repaired following two morning wrecks at the location.

The first wreck, in the early morning hours, caused the outage, according to information from the Cullman mayor’s office

A second wreck happened at the intersection of U.S. 278 and 4th Avenue next to The Cullman Times around 9:15. Cullman police officers directed traffic for two hours until the signals were restored.
